History 

In 2005, physical therapists Patrick Hoban and Brandon Lorenz, along with business manager Tony Castaldi founded Probility Physical Therapy as a private practice. After years of working in a world of typical physical therapy clinics, where the customer service was subpar and the treatment generic, they decided to create an amazing therapy experience through Probility Physical Therapy.

Probility became a wholly owned division of the Saint Joseph Mercy Health System in 2015. The acquisition allowed Probility to expand its services to a greater service area to make a difference in a growing number of people’s lives.
